Moto G13 finally launched in India: Here’s what you need to know | Digit

Motorola has launched a new Moto G series phone in India today which is believed to be the second most affordable smartphone in the country by Motorola. The Moto G13 was rolled out in the European market in January and is scheduled to launch in India in March. 

The Moto G13 launch has completed the availability of all the G series phones in India including Moto G23, Moto G53 and Moto G73. 

The Moto G13 comes with an entry-level price and carries decent sets of features. Here are the specifications of the budget phone:

Moto G13 specifications

Moto G13

Moto G13 comes with a 6.5-inch IPS LCD display with a resolution of 1600 x 720 pixels. The display panel supports up to 90Hz refresh rate.

Moto G13 is powered by the MediaTek Helio G85 chipset and the phone runs on the Android 13 operating system. Along with that, the company promised the Android 14 update and three years of security updates.

The smartphone rolls out with a triple camera setup on the back holding a 50-megapixel primary shooter, a 2-megapixel macro lens and a 2-megapixel depth sensor. On the front, it has an 8-megapixel selfie shooter.

It packs a 5000mAh battery with 10 watts of charging.

The phone also comes with dual stereo speakers which are powered by Dolby Atmos. It also features a side-mounted fingerprint sensor, a 3.5mm headphone jack, and a dedicated MicroSD card slot.

Moto G13 price and availability

Moto G13

The smartphone will be available from April 5 on Flipkart and other leading retail stores across the country. It is launched in India at a starting price of ₹9,499 for the 64GB variant and ₹9,999 for the 128GB variant.
